We are enabling the Greywater lint ruleset on all SQL files in the Maplecourt repositories. Support should expect customer-facing teams to ask why pipeline checks now fail on uppercase keywords and missing semicolons. The rules are warnings for two weeks, then errors. A suppression comment syntax exists and is documented in the Greywater guide; please point users there rather than disabling the check. This rollout cannot proceed to the enforcement phase until written sign-off is received from the approver named below.

signatory, yagap-bawig: Ulaath Eliath

# Break-Glass: Catalog Cache Invalidation

Scope: the Pinrow product catalog at Veldstone Retail. If stale prices persist after a purge and the Hollowmere invalidation queue is wedged, use break-glass to flush the edge tier directly. Contractors: get verbal sign-off from the catalog lead first. Steps: open the Hollowmere admin shell, select emergency-flush, confirm the tenant, and run it once — repeated flushes thrash the origin. Access is logged and expires after 20 minutes. Unseal the admin shell with the passphrase below.

recovery phrase for kahop-tajog: istix-casvan

☐ Step 9 — Dark mode, yes really. Before we lock the Glimmerbox admin keys, plugin authors need to confirm their panels render correctly with the new dark-mode theme — no white flashes, no unreadable badges. Check your widgets in the Nocturne staging dashboard and tick the box in the ceremony log. Once everyone's signed off, open the ceremony vault using the recovery passphrase just below.

vault phrase of fahog-yajog = frawyn-jordor-casael-gormir-olieth-julmir